Governor Pingree Tax Reform and Peace Advocate View

Governor Pingree urges equal taxation with emphasis on bringing railroads and major firms under general tax laws and repealing special corporate charters. He backs a moderate income tax on incomes over 10 000 and notes fears over trusts. Carnegie praises peace efforts and stresses industrial union, plebiscite caution, and unity against imperialism.

McKinley Southern Trip From a Negro's Standpoint

A Savannah Baptist Truth letter argues McKinley's reconciliation tour harms Negroes paving the way for continued separation. It denounces racial prejudice at Atlanta's Peace Jubilee, recalls Negro contributions at Santiago, and urges Populist organizing for 1900.
